How to Become a Food Servers, Nonrestaurant in Missouri

Food Servers, Nonrestaurants in Missouri earn a median salary of $31,080/year, which is 10% below the national average. Missouri has a state income tax of ~2.2%. After taxes and rent, a food servers, nonrestaurant takes home approximately $782/month. Most positions require No formal educational credential.

Food Servers, Nonrestaurant salary by metro area in Missouri

Metro areaMedianHourlyEmployment
St. Louis$34K$16.39/hr2,350
Kansas City$32K$15.32/hr1,310
Columbia$32K$15.27/hr240
Joplin$31K$15/hr110
Springfield$30K$14.35/hr350
Cape Girardeau$29K$14.15/hr120
St. Joseph$29K$13.78/hr60

How much does a food servers, nonrestaurant make in Missouri?

The median food servers, nonrestaurant salary in Missouri is $31,080 per year ($14.94/hr). This is 10% below the national median of $34,460. Salaries range from $26,380 to $38,290.

Can a food servers, nonrestaurant afford to live in Missouri?

At the median salary of $31,080, a food servers, nonrestaurant in Missouri would take home approximately $2,194/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 64.4%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.

What are the best cities for food servers, nonrestaurants in Missouri?

The highest paying metro areas for food servers, nonrestaurants in Missouri are St. Louis ($34,090), Kansas City ($31,860), Columbia ($31,760). However, cost of living varies significantly between metros — a higher salary may not mean more purchasing power.
